Example #1
0
        private void btnCargar_Click(object sender, EventArgs e)
        {
            DiaLaboral dia      = new DiaLaboral();
            Date       fechaIni = new Date(cmbFechaInicio.Value);
            Date       fechaFin = new Date(cmbFechaFin.Value);

            if (ckbxEmpleado.Checked == true)
            {
                if (ckbxAsistencia.Checked == true)
                {
                    int    idemp = (int)cmbEmpleado.SelectedValue;
                    String asist = cmbAsistencia.SelectedItem.ToString();
                    dgvAsistencias.DataSource = dia.reporteEmpleadoAsistencia(idemp, fechaIni, fechaFin, asist, this.conexion);
                }
                else
                {
                    int idemp = (int)cmbEmpleado.SelectedValue;
                    dgvAsistencias.DataSource = dia.reporteEmpleado(idemp, fechaIni, fechaFin, this.conexion);
                }
            }
            else
            {
                if (ckbxAsistencia.Checked == true)
                {
                    String asist = cmbAsistencia.SelectedItem.ToString();
                    dgvAsistencias.DataSource = dia.reporteAsistencia(fechaIni, fechaFin, asist, this.conexion);
                }
                else
                {
                    dgvAsistencias.DataSource = dia.reporteGeneral(fechaIni, fechaFin, this.conexion);
                }
            }
        }
Example #2
0
        private void btnCargar_Click(object sender, EventArgs e)
        {
            DiaLaboral        dia = new DiaLaboral();
            List <DiaLaboral> dias;
            Date fechaIni = new Date(cmbFechaInicio.Value);
            Date fechaFin = new Date(cmbFechaFin.Value);

            if (ckbxEmpleado.Checked == true)
            {
                if (ckbxAsistencia.Checked == true)
                {
                    int    idemp = Convert.ToInt32(cmbEmpleados.SelectedItem.ToString());
                    String asist = cmbAsistencia.SelectedItem.ToString();
                    dias = dia.reporteEmpleadoAsistencia(idemp, fechaIni, fechaFin, asist, this.conexion);
                    carguarDGV(dias);
                }
                else
                {
                    int idemp = Convert.ToInt32(cmbEmpleados.SelectedItem.ToString());
                    dias = dia.reporteEmpleado(idemp, fechaIni, fechaFin, this.conexion);
                    carguarDGV(dias);
                }
            }
            else
            {
                if (ckbxAsistencia.Checked == true)
                {
                    String asist = cmbAsistencia.SelectedItem.ToString();
                    dias = dia.reporteAsistencia(fechaIni, fechaFin, asist, this.conexion);
                    carguarDGV(dias);
                }
                else
                {
                    dias = dia.reporteGeneral(fechaIni, fechaFin, this.conexion);
                    carguarDGV(dias);
                }
            }
        }